Output f3ba854ed824906c8ac12bdc260f9af30dc53e8392af067510e9b225612e360d:3

value
27231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 964a9aa2c97067a7d4454c4cddbbf4b9ca4a653e OP_EQUAL
address
3FPgeu4FzH4YHMoiNdpBcbvZEmf2GxasBa
transaction
f3ba854ed824906c8ac12bdc260f9af30dc53e8392af067510e9b225612e360d
confirmations
188986
spent
true